Here are the two basic ways to check if a rear turn signal on your car is out of order or if you need to change it fairly quickly:

  • When you stop, turn on the ignition on your Toyota Scion FR S, then alternately turn on your left and right rear turn signals and get out of the car to check that they are functioning.
  • By listening to the sound of your turn signals. In fact, there is an audible signal on each car that alerts you of a rear turn signal bulb burnt out on your Toyota Scion FR S, you will notice that the time between each “click” is much closer, this suggests that that you will have to change the rear turn signal bulb or before. It’s up to you to examine and validate which one is burnt out by a visual check as on the first strategy shown above.

Changing the rear turn signal bulb on my Toyota Scion FR S

Now let’s go to the most important part of this article content, how to change the rear turn signal bulb on Toyota Scion FR S? Please note that this method is quite easy, you will need to access, from the inside of your trunk, your headlight unit, open it and replace the burnt out rear turn signal bulb on your car. On the other hand, here are the full description to adhere to in order to perform this process correctly:

  • To access the tail light assembly, take out the carpeting or plastic cover to access the tail light assembly.
  • Use a screwdriver or torx wrench (6-pointed star) to open the tail light assembly.
  • Take out the rear indicator bulb from your burnt-out turn signal that you have previously diagnosed by an external visual inspection, for this you will need to make a quarter turn in a counter-clockwise way
  • Change the rear turn signal bulb on your Toyota Scion FR S. There are two sort of bulbs, transparent bulbs when the cover is orange, or orange bulbs when the cover is transparent, select the right model for your car

  • Put back in place your rear turn signal bulb and close your tail light block, then, check your new turn signal bulb is working in the right way
